2. Enkrypt Wallet Integrates Payment ID (20 June 2025)

Overview: In June 2025, the multi-chain wallet Enkrypt, developed by MyEtherWallet, integrated SPACE ID's Payment ID solution. This feature allows users to send crypto to any centralized exchange using a simple name instead of a long deposit address, reducing error risk. The integration also added support for SPACE ID domain names.

What this means: This is positive for SPACE ID as it expands the practical utility of its identity products directly into user wallets. By simplifying a key pain point—CEX deposits—it enhances user experience and encourages broader adoption of SPACE ID's ecosystem. (CoinMarketCap)

1. Payment ID Integration with Enkrypt (June 2025)

Overview: This update integrated SPACE ID's Payment ID solution into the Enkrypt wallet. It lets users send funds to any centralized exchange deposit address using just a registered name (like 'alice'), eliminating the risk of errors from copying long cryptographic addresses.

The technical integration involved SPACE ID's proprietary SDK, enabling the wallet to resolve a user's simple Payment ID to the correct, chain-specific deposit address on the fly. This builds on the Payment ID system that launched on MetaMask and Binance in April 2025.

What this means: This is bullish for SPACE ID because it significantly improves the user experience for a common task—moving crypto to an exchange. By making transactions simpler and safer, it encourages broader adoption of SPACE ID's identity tools beyond just domain ownership.

3. DappRadar Portfolio Integration (December 2025)

Overview: This update made SPACE ID domains natively supported on the DappRadar analytics platform. Users can now view their portfolio holdings linked to a readable domain name (e.g., yourname.bnb) instead of an opaque, hexadecimal wallet address.

The integration works by having DappRadar's platform resolve the domain to its underlying address, seamlessly displaying the simplified identity across its tracking and analytics features.

What this means: This is bullish for SPACE ID because it embeds its utility into a widely used tool for tracking crypto assets. It enhances the practical value of owning a domain by making portfolio management clearer and more user-friendly, which can drive further registrations.
